Frost Bros.

Index Frost Bros.

Frost Bros. was a high-fashion retail chain based in San Antonio, Texas. [1]

Irving Allen Mathews

Irving Allen Mathews (8 Apr 1917 Toledo, Ohio – 7 February 1994, San Antonio) was an American specialty retail executive, who devoted 41 years to Frost Bros., formerly of San Antonio, Texas.
